Thanks for the follow up Simon. One question... On Aug 11, 2016, at 12:12 AM, Simon McVittie wrote:
>gbp pq works best if all repository users stick to the dialect of DEP-3 >where all Debian-specific pseudo-headers appear at the end of the diff >(next to the Signed-off-by if any), Did you mean to say "end of the diff headers"? I ask because in your "Good for gbp-pq" example: > From: Donald Duck <don...@example.com> > Date: Fri, 01 Apr 2016 12:34:00 +0100 > Subject: Reticulate splines correctly > > This regressed in 2.0. > > In particular, this broke embiggening. > > Origin: vendor, Debian > Forwarded: http://bugs.example.org/123 > --- > [diff goes here] the DEP-3 headers are *before* the actual diff, separated from the diff headers by a blank line.
